Output dd066c97cfaf99f9c17ab5b3a2726171d9ac2e5afea941a0c29fe9074eea981a:2

value
141196968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f1f98a34da9f7e6dd4ed612030a21ed0a48e9b OP_EQUAL
address
3EuR6sLmJkorpjuRqeWQhua5P9MD7xsdCy
transaction
dd066c97cfaf99f9c17ab5b3a2726171d9ac2e5afea941a0c29fe9074eea981a
spent
true